Apple sauce

Rate this recipe
Delightfully fresh apple sauce.

Ingredients (6)

4 apples — Granny Smith, peeled and cored
150 g butter
1 brown sugar
1 cinnamon — stick
salt and freshly ground black pepper
1/2 cup water

Method:

Chop the apples roughly into 2 cm blocks.

Melt the butter in a heavy based sauce pot; add the apples, sugar, cinnamon, salt, pepper and water.

Place a lid on the pot and cook for 15 to 20 minutes, until the apples are completely cooked and soft.

Remove the cinnamon stick.

Blend the apples in a food processor until smooth, season to taste.

The sauce can be served either hot or cold with roasted pork.
